Teaching Methods
Lectures and practical classes.
The theoretical classes are lecture based.
Practical classes complement and clarify the theoretical concepts through solving practical exercises in cosmography, the analysis of aerological diagrams and basic synoptic maps, the graphical representation of climate information and the classification of climates.
Learning Outcomes
This class is an introduction to the study of the Earth's atmosphere on a global scale, with the fundamental objectives of analysis of climatic-meteorological variables that characterize it and the processes and factors that explain them.
It is intended that students understand "climate" from its temporal variability and spatial diversity.

NoSyllabus
1. Climatology: introduction
2. Cosmographic fundamentals of climate zonality. Rythms of insolation
3. Composition, structure and dynamics of the convective atmosphere
4. Energy balance and atmospheric temperature.
5. Atmospheric humidity and precipitation
6. General atmospheric circulation.
Atmospheric disturbances
7. Climactic Typology
